Panfrost driver certificeret til OpenGL ES 3.1 kompatibilitet til Valhall Series Mali GPU'er

Collabora har annonceret, at Khronos har certificeret Panfrost-grafikdriveren på systemer med Mali GPU'er baseret på Valhall-mikroarkitekturen (Mali-G57). Driveren har bestået alle test af CTS (Khronos Conformance Test Suite) og er fundet fuldt ud kompatibel med OpenGL ES 3.1-specifikationen. Sidste år blev en lignende certificering gennemført for Mali-G52 GPU baseret på Bifrost-mikroarkitekturen.

At opnå certifikatet giver dig mulighed for officielt at erklære kompatibilitet med grafikstandarder og bruge de tilhørende Khronos-varemærker. Certificeringen åbner også døren for, at Panfrost-driveren kan bruges i produkter, herunder Mali G52 og G57 GPU'erne. For eksempel bruges Mali-G57 GPU'en i Chromebooks baseret på MediaTek MT8192 og MT8195 SoC'erne.

Testen blev udført i et miljø med distributionen Debian GNU/Linux 12, Mesa og X.Org X Server 1.21.1.3. De rettelser og forbedringer, der er forberedt som forberedelse til certificering, er allerede blevet overført til Mesa og vil være en del af udgivelse 22.2. Relaterede ændringer til DRM (Direct Rendering Manager) kerneundersystemet er blevet indsendt til medtagelse i Linux-hovedkernen.

Panfrost-driveren blev grundlagt i 2018 af Alyssa Rosenzweig fra Collabora og blev udviklet ved reverse engineering af de originale ARM-drivere. Udviklerne har siden sidste år etableret et samarbejde med firmaet ARM, som har leveret den nødvendige information og dokumentation. I øjeblikket understøtter driveren chips baseret på Midgard (Mali-T6xx, Mali-T7xx, Mali-T8xx), Bifrost (Mali G3x, G5x, G7x) og Valhall (Mali G57+) mikroarkitekturer. Til GPU Mali 400/450, brugt i mange ældre chips baseret på ARM-arkitektur, udvikles Lima-driveren separat.

Kilde: opennet.ru

Tilføj en kommentar